Contract documents and specifications have been prepared for Contract 24-670-11, Inspection and Repair of Cranes and Hoists at Various Locations, at the request of the Maintenance and Operations Department.

 

The purpose of this contract is to inspect and repair cranes and hoists at the District’s various facilities for a three-year period.

 

The estimated cost for this contract is not to exceed $953,900.00. The estimated 2024, 2025, 2026 and 2027 expenditures are $350,000.00, $335,000.00, $178,000.00, and $90,900.00, respectively. 

 

The Multi-Project Labor Agreement (MPLA) will be included in this contract.

 

The Affirmative Action Ordinance, Revised Appendix D and Appendix V will not be included in this contract due to the limited availability of MBE/WBE/VBE participants who can provide the inspection and repair services.

 

The tentative schedule for this contract is as follows:

Advertise                     November 22, 2023

Bid Opening:                     January 9, 2024

Award                                          February 1, 2024

Completion                      March 1, 2027

                    

Funds are being requested in 2024 in Accounts 101-67000/68000/69000-612240/612680. Funds for the subsequent years, 2025, 2026, and 2027, are contingent upon the Board of Commissioners’ approval of the District’s budget for those years.

 

In view of the foregoing, it is recommended that the Director of Procurement and Materials Management be authorized to advertise Contract 24-670-11.
